Outline Koju 2 is a bold, wide, medium cont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

A heavy, block-based outline design with a clear double-line/inline construction: a thick outer contour and a secondary inner rule that creates a hollow, sign-painter feel. Curves are broadly rounded while terminals and joins stay mostly squared-off, giving the alphabet a sturdy, poster-like rhythm. Proportions run on the wide side with generous counters; the lowercase is simple and open, with single-storey forms and compact, uniform bowls. Numerals follow the same outlined structure, maintaining consistent stroke spacing and a stable, upright stance across the set.
This style is best suited to large-size applications where the outline and inline detail can be appreciated—headlines, posters, signage, packaging callouts, and logo marks. It can also work for short promotional text or titles where a strong, graphic presence is desired more than continuous-reading comfort.
The overall tone is upbeat and nostalgic, evoking classic display lettering used on storefronts, team graphics, and mid-century advertising. The outlined build reads energetic and friendly rather than formal, with enough weight and presence to feel celebratory and attention-seeking.
The design appears intended to deliver a high-impact display voice using a hollow, inline outline structure that adds dimensionality without shading. Its wide, rounded geometry suggests an aim toward approachable, retro-leaning branding and bold titling.
The interior rule is consistently inset, producing a crisp, layered silhouette that holds together well at display sizes. Shapes favor clarity over intricacy, with minimal modulation and a straightforward geometric logic that keeps wordforms bold and graphic.
